I really have been in an experimenting mood recently :-) Something I always wanted to try was making my own molds for things to add to my scrapbooking and art pieces.
I did a little bit of research, and the simplest method is to use a silicone putty which consists of two compounds which have to be mixed together. You then press the object into the mixture, let the whole thing sit for a while until it hardens. I have explained the process in my blog which has an English translation:

The molds can be used for polymer clay, air-drying clay, chocolate, wax and what else you can think of.
The process is a lot of fun, and you can really add personal things to your creative artwork.
